Artichoke with Chicken and White Sauce
A new and unusual artichoke recipe with chicken in a white sauce. Serve this dish with basmati rice and any kind of green salad.

Ingredients
- Pieces of boneless chicken breasts
- Fresh or frozen artichokes, cleaned and trimmed of leaves
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 2 tablespoons flour
- Chicken stock
- 1 tablespoon milk powder
- A pinch of nutmeg
- 1 teaspoon white spice
- Salt
Method
- Boil the chicken after washing it well. Add all the aromatics — cinnamon sticks, cardamom pods, onion and bay leaves — to the chicken's boiling water.
- When the chicken is cooked, shred it into small pieces.
- Cut the artichokes into medium pieces, boil them for about 5 minutes, then place them in a colander and toss them with oil until they brown. In a pot over the heat, put butter and flour to prepare the white sauce similar to béchamel. Add the chicken broth with the butter and flour, then powdered milk — the mixture should remain loose and not thick, while taking care not to make it runny...Timers: 5 min
- When the mixture thickens, add a grating of nutmeg, white pepper and salt. When it comes to a boil, add the chicken and the artichoke pieces and let them simmer for about 12 minutes over low heat. Serve the artichoke with chicken and white sauce with plain basmati rice.Timers: 12 min
